Shifting Strategy for DOGE

  • 🎯 The Department of Government Efficiency (DOGE) is reportedly reconsidering its "move fast and break things" strategy due to growing impatience from the public and within the Trump administration.
  • πŸ“’ President Trump announced that cabinet officials, rather than DOGE or Elon Musk, would lead decisions on cost-cutting and firings, using a "scalpel rather than a hatchet" approach.
  • ⚑ This shift is interpreted as a reaction to backlash from Trump's base, indicating that public sentiment is influencing his decisions.

Internal Conflicts and Public Perception

  • πŸ’₯ A fiery confrontation reportedly occurred between Elon Musk and Trump's cabinet members, with Musk clashing with Secretary of State Marco Rubio over State Department employee firings.
  • πŸ—£οΈ Trump intervened, defending Rubio and downplaying the conflict, though his subsequent denial on X is seen by some as evidence of a significant dispute.
  • πŸ“Š Public opinion on DOGE's work is divided, with polls showing both disapproval of Elon Musk's involvement and majority support for influencing government spending and cutting staff.

Challenges in Measuring Public Opinion

  • ❓ The reliability of polling on DOGE's effectiveness is questioned, with conflicting results from different sources like the Washington Post and CNN.
  • πŸ“‰ The general support for cutting government waste contrasts with specific opposition to cuts affecting individual services like Social Security, Medicare, and mail services.
  • ⚠️ It's suggested that public opinion may shift significantly once the cuts begin to directly impact people's daily lives and entitlement programs.

DOGE's Public Relations Crisis

  • πŸ“ˆ DOGE is facing significant internal worry about its public relations and perception, with a need to champion positive achievements.
  • πŸ’° Elon Musk is reportedly considering offering DOGE dividends, a move seen as a potentially effective, albeit controversial, strategy to gain public favor.
  • ⚠️ Concerns are raised that such a plan might be a short-term fix, potentially masking deeper issues or leading to the erosion of essential services like Social Security.

Upcoming Policy Concerns

  • πŸ“‰ The House's budget blueprint demands significant cuts to Medicaid, far exceeding estimated waste, fraud, and abuse.
  • πŸ’Έ A potential large tax cut for the wealthy, coupled with cuts to essential services, is predicted to be deeply unpopular and could significantly damage Trump's standing.
  • πŸ“’ Accurate media coverage and consistent messaging from Democrats are deemed crucial for informing the public about these policy changes.
